Is there anyway to get my weapon permanent enchanted in Skyrim ?

I want to get my weapon permanent enchanted in Skyrim so I don't have to recharge it anymore, Is there anyway ?Is there anyway to get my weapon permanent enchanted in Skyrim ?
when you enchant a weapon you are basically putting energy from a soul gem into it. That energy runs out. But you can recharge it with more soul gems
Permanent enchantments weren't programmed into the Elder Scrolls games because it allow weapons to be ridiculously overpowered (permanent greater life leach enchantment would pretty much make you invincible, for instance). The closest you can get is enchanting/recharging with a grand soul gem.Is there anyway to get my weapon permanent enchanted in Skyrim ?

Yes there is. Do Azura's Daedric quest to get Azura's star. It is essentially the same as infinite soul gems.
There isnt really any way to do that although there is a Daedric artefact that acts as a soul gem but never breaks, its called Azura's Star
